ALA Webinar Library Available to Members 24/7 at No Additional Fee

Starting in 2024, ALA is offering all members free access to the popular On-demand Training Library — which now features all webinars immediately after they air, including the recent April session featuring Dan Blitzer, FIES, LC, titled Winning Techniques for Selling Residential Lighting

In the past, there was an additional fee associated with ALA's live webinars; however, as part of the new member benefits that rolled out this year, there is no longer a fee for ALA's monthly webinar courses. Every employee at all ALA-member companies can access live and recorded ALA webinar sessions.

Free access to the on-demand library is just one of many new services and programs that ALA has unveiled to members this year — including a national healthcare plan, which is saving money for companies of all sizes.

Along with the webinars, ALA has launched a free member forum series, which consists of regularly scheduled virtual meetings between ALA members and featuring noted experts speaking on topics relevant to each segment of the membership.

Next month’s member forum will be held Wednesday, May 15, at 12 p.m., CDT. The topic is targeted to manufacturer members and will cover the extended producer responsibility laws related to plastic and packaging of products. Rachel Michelin, president of the California Retailers Association, will briefly touch on California’s SB 54 — the state law that implemented goals for reducing packaging and packaging waste, shifting the burden of responsibility away from the consumers and to the producer.
